BYT 2024 is now open for candidates

Applications to the 11th edition of the Blue Young Talent program are now open until May 15th, 2024.

Applications for the BYT and BYTplus programs are now open

 

All information about the program and the application process is available on theBYT website.

Similar to previous editions of the BYT programs, students will have the opportunity to work integrated into CIIMAR research teams, receiving a monthly scholarship during the program period. Additionally, they will have access to CIIMAR facilities and its research, innovation, technology transfer, training, and education resources, as well as a complementary network of technological platforms. Students will also be integrated into a pre- or post-graduate enrichment program aimed at promoting excellence, communication and scientific dissemination of their work, entrepreneurship, and integration into the job market.

 
As in previous editions, both BYT and BYTplus will conclude with a public presentation of the work developed by young talents, with the distinction of the best projects.
 
The eleventh edition will feature pre-graduate BYT scholarships funded by Soja Portugal and the Amadeu Dias Foundation, while the sixth edition of the BYTplus program will again be funded by the Amadeu Dias Foundation.
 
Applications for all BYT programs must be submitted by completing and submitting the appropriate form available on the BYT website during the application period: April 15th to May 15th, 2024.
